The Republic of Kosovo is recognized by half of the UB member countries.
More than 51% of the world countries have recognized it so far”.

In an analysis of the 365 days that were left behind, the Foreign Minister of Kosovo, Enver Hoxhaj, underlined that the country won 13 recognitions during this year, spread throughout the globe.

As regards the five EU member countries that have not recognized Kosovo’s independence, Minister Hoxhaj says that while Serbia is going towards Kosovo’s independence recognition, Greece, Spain, Slovakia, Romania and Cyprus have no more reasons to not do the same.

The political dialogue between Kosovo and Serbia, according to the head of the Kosovo diplomacy, is being used as an argument to change the approach of these countries to Kosovo, and this is done through direct information.

Minister Hoxhaj also declared that the appointment of the Kosovo Ambassador in Belgrade will be held on January 2013. Hoxhaj steps that it is an important step to have the presence of a Kosovo ambassador in a country that is against independence, such as Serbia.

“For us, this office that serves as a connection with Belgrade is a complete diplomatic representation. The same will be for Serbia’s connection office and the man they will send with diplomatic privileges, and that will represent Kosovo in Belgrade”, Hoxhaj underlined.

“Kosovo and Serbia have had a difficult past, and it’s important for this person to be well prepared, to know the Serbian language and culture, and to project dynamism on the behalf of the Kosovo citizens”.

Hoxhaj also mentioned Kosovo’s membership at the EBRD, for which they received the vote of two countries that have not recognized its independence yet, such as Slovakia and Greece.
